The time required to power wash a driveway isn’t a static number but a dynamic equation where variables like surface type, contamination level, and equipment efficiency play starring roles. At its core, the process involves three phases: preparation, active cleaning, and post-treatment. The first phase—inspecting the surface for cracks, sealant integrity, and embedded debris—can eat up 20% of the total time if overlooked. For example, a driveway with deep cracks may require pre-treatment with a degreaser or crack filler before pressure washing, adding 30–60 minutes to the timeline. Meanwhile, the active cleaning phase, where the pressure washer does its work, is where most homeowners miscalculate. What they assume will take an hour often stretches to three because of inconsistent pressure, improper nozzle selection, or failure to section off the work area.
Commercial operations, on the other hand, treat driveway power washing as a system. A crew of two might divide a 1,200-square-foot parking lot into quadrants, using a 3,000 PSI machine with a rotating turbo nozzle to cover each section in 10–15 minutes. The key difference? They account for downtime—switching nozzles, refilling detergent tanks, and addressing unexpected issues like stubborn rust or tire marks. For DIYers, this lack of planning is the silent time-sink. Core Mechanisms: How It Works
Pressure washing a driveway operates on a simple principle: directed water at high velocity dislodges dirt, oil, and algae. However, the mechanics behind it are more nuanced. The pressure washer’s pump forces water through a nozzle at speeds of 500–4,000 feet per second, creating a jet that can strip paint, loosen gravel, or even etch concrete if misused. The choice of nozzle—whether a narrow 0-degree tip for deep cleaning or a wide 40-degree fan for delicate surfaces—dictates how quickly the job progresses. For instance, a 25-degree nozzle at 3,000 PSI will cover less area per pass than a 40-degree nozzle at 1,500 PSI, but it may be necessary for stubborn stains. This trade-off between speed and effectiveness is why professionals often carry multiple nozzles and adjust settings mid-project.
The actual cleaning process involves three steps: pre-wetting the surface to soften grime, applying detergent or degreaser, and then rinsing with the pressure washer. The time saved in skipping the pre-wet phase is often lost in re-cleaning areas where dirt re-deposits during the rinse. Similarly, using the wrong detergent can leave a film that requires additional passes, extending the total time. For example, a driveway with heavy oil stains might need a dedicated degreaser and two rinses—one to lift the oil, another to remove residue—adding 30–45 minutes to the process. Comparative Analysis
The time it takes to power wash a driveway varies dramatically based on who’s doing the work. Below is a side-by-side comparison of DIY vs. professional approaches:
| Factor | DIY (Homeowner) | Professional Crew |
|---|---|---|
| Average Time for 500 sq. ft. | 1.5–3 hours (with prep) | 45–90 minutes |
| Equipment Cost | $50–$100/day rental | Included in service fee |
| Common Time-Wasters | Nozzle clogs, improper pressure, re-cleaning missed spots | Minimal downtime; crew coordination |
| Surface Damage Risk | Higher (inexperience with PSI settings) | Lower (insured equipment, trained operators) |

Q: Does the type of driveway material affect how long it takes to clean?
A: Absolutely. Concrete and asphalt have different porosity and stain absorption rates. Concrete driveways with a sealed finish may take 20–30% longer to clean because the sealant requires gentle pressure to avoid stripping. Asphalt, which is more porous, can absorb stains deeper, often necessitating a degreaser and two rinses, adding 15–25 minutes to the process. Gravel driveways, meanwhile, require careful nozzle selection to avoid displacing stones, extending the time by 40% or more.
Q: Will using a higher PSI setting make the job go faster?
A: Not necessarily. While a 4,000 PSI machine can strip stains more aggressively, it also increases the risk of surface damage (e.g., etching concrete or loosening asphalt). Professionals often use 2,500–3,000 PSI for driveways, adjusting with nozzle angles to balance speed and safety. Using too high a PSI can actually slow you down—you’ll spend more time repairing damaged areas than cleaning. For most residential driveways, 1,500–2,500 PSI with a 25–40 degree nozzle is ideal.

Q: Can I power wash a driveway in cold weather?
A: Cold weather (below 40°F) can make power washing ineffective and even damaging. Water freezes quickly, leaving streaks and preventing proper drying. Additionally, cold temperatures can cause concrete to contract, making it more susceptible to cracking under pressure. If you must clean in cooler months, use a heated pressure washer (200°F+) or wait until temperatures rise above 50°F. For asphalt, avoid cleaning when temperatures drop below freezing to prevent sealant damage.
